Olof. I was aware of the prohibition.
Sommar. And you dared to defy it?
Olof. Yes, when the people were let go like sheep without a shepherd, I wanted to keep them together.
Sommar. You seem to be finding fault with our actions. That's impudence indeed.
Olof. Truth is always impudent.
Sommar. I believe, young man, that you want to play the part of an apostle of truth. It will bring you no thanks.
Olof. All I ask is ingratitude.
Sommar. Save your truths. They don't retain their value in the market very long.
Olof (impetuously). That's advice worthy of the Father of Lies!—(Mildly.) I ask your pardon!
Sommar. Do you know to whom you are talking?
